在asp.net2.0中使用电子邮件(使用SMTP客户端)以大于2mb的大小发送文件作为附件时出现操作超时错误
答案 0 :(得分:1)
如果你可以提供更多关于你的问题的背景/信息会很好,但是我会猜测 - 我假设你想知道“为什么”它的超时,以及如何解决它。
嗯,很简单,SMTP事务在ASP.NET中具有超时值(与大多数事情一样),您需要更改它以满足您的需求。
您需要将SMTP对象上的Timeout属性设置为更高的值。
更多信息here
该属性以毫秒为单位(默认值为100秒)。
您还需要在web.config中增加ASP.NET MaxRequestSize。